
Showing posts from October, 2010

This is Halloween

Yes, Yes. I know. It's a very American thing. But this guy lives in America, so I'm allowed to post it, ok?

Rescue Chopper at Lake Placid

The EMQ Rescue Helicopter has been buzzing Lake Placid and Barron Gorge last night and early today, does anyone know what's going on?